History of Present Illness in 2021

Q:

Should we continue to require HPI information for each problem in 2021?

A:

Answer: While we are certainly thankful for the 2021 guideline changes, we should not be so quick to put HPI and exam on the shelf. Codes 99202-99215 are defined as requiring medically necessary history and exam. While the extent may be determined by the clinician, the information documented should still convey current status and the need for interventions for each condition addressed. If BCA could vote to keep one component of the previous guidelines, it would decidedly be the Incoming Status rule for HPI. BCA recommends keeping this as a best practice for documentation. This approach will tell a clear story of today’s encounter and assist with capturing medical necessity for the service and any resultant orders.
